协议属性是指在计算机网络中,用于定义通信双方之间交换数据的规则和约定。它可以包括数据传输格式、通信方式、错误检测和纠正机制等内容。协议属性的使用与领域相关,可以根据具体的应用场景和需求来选择合适的协议属性。
在云计算领域中,协议属性的选择对于实现高效、安全和可靠的数据传输至关重要。以下是一些常见的协议属性及其应用场景:
- 数据传输格式:协议属性可以定义数据的编码方式,如二进制、文本等。不同的数据传输格式适用于不同的应用场景。例如,JSON格式适用于Web API的数据传输,而二进制格式适用于高性能计算和大规模数据处理。
- 通信方式:协议属性可以定义通信双方之间的通信方式,如同步通信、异步通信、请求-响应模式、发布-订阅模式等。不同的通信方式适用于不同的应用场景。例如,同步通信适用于实时交互的应用,而异步通信适用于批量数据处理和消息队列等场景。
- 错误检测和纠正机制:协议属性可以定义错误检测和纠正机制,以确保数据传输的可靠性和完整性。常见的机制包括校验和、重传机制、冗余数据等。这些机制可以帮助检测和修复在数据传输过程中可能出现的错误。
- 安全性:协议属性可以定义安全性相关的机制,如加密、身份验证、访问控制等。这些机制可以保护数据的机密性、完整性和可用性,防止未经授权的访问和数据泄露。
- 性能优化:协议属性可以针对特定的应用场景进行性能优化。例如,通过压缩算法减小数据传输的大小,通过并行传输提高数据传输的速度,通过缓存机制减少网络延迟等。
在腾讯云的产品中,有一些与协议属性相关的产品可以提供支持。例如:
- 腾讯云CDN(内容分发网络):提供全球加速、缓存、压缩等功能,优化数据传输的性能和可靠性。详情请参考:腾讯云CDN产品介绍
- 腾讯云SSL证书:提供数字证书,用于加密通信和身份验证,保护数据的安全性。详情请参考:腾讯云SSL证书产品介绍
- 腾讯云消息队列CMQ(Cloud Message Queue):提供高可靠、高可用的消息队列服务,支持异步通信和发布-订阅模式。详情请参考:腾讯云消息队列CMQ产品介绍
总之,协议属性在云计算领域中起着重要的作用,可以根据具体的应用场景和需求选择合适的协议属性,以实现高效、安全和可靠的数据传输。腾讯云提供了一系列相关产品,可以帮助用户实现协议属性的要求。